- 首先在data里面定义一个num
- 找到购物车中的数量,将数量给这个data里面的num,(注意:找到的data要转成字符串的形式:toString()方法)
- 在购物车的js中写上:
num(){
if (this.data.num == '') {
//如果还未添加商品时候,可使用这个wx.removeTabBarBadge来移除
wx.removeTabBarBadge({//移除tabbar右上角的文本
index: 2,//tabbar下标
})
} else {
//添加商品后通过wx.setTabBarBadge来进行设置
wx.setTabBarBadge({//tabbar右上角添加文本
index: 2,//tabbar下标
text: this.data.num //显示的内容,必须为字符串可通过toString()将number转为字符串
})
}
},